A platform connecting real materials to assess and support informed decision making
Whereas the choice of materials can influence up to 60% of the cost and 85% of the road project carbon footprint, material sourcing for road construction was historically considered at the last stages of a project. The complexity and the deep ground knowledge necessary for sourcing evaluations result in standardized designs based on assumptions and with little consideration for the local material availability. ORIS brings a new approach to the entire ecosystem with a deep local materials knowledge for all geographies. ORIS is a material intelligence platform gathering materials information and knowledge accessible for the construction ecosystem. Using local resources based on circularity enable to reduce the use of natural resources in road construction by up to 80% and the carbon footprint by up to 50%. ORIS enables each player of the road industry to collaborate better: - authorities to plan more sustainable road programs, - engineers to control the carbon emission of their project, - funders to follow their green finance objectives and KPIs - contractors to leverage more circular economy and recycling contents and materials suppliers to participate actively. ORIS services are paving the way to sustainable road construction providing circular, low-carbon, resource - and competitive solutions.

ORIS by Holcim
Implemented by Aggregate Industries in Carlisle (United Kingdom) in 2021
Aggregate Industries, a building material company, collaborated with ORIS for the 6-km reconstruction of an existing carriageway in Cumbria county. This £8 m project for National Highways was identified as the first UK Carbon Neutral Scheme. The tool was able to generate multiple design options within the pavement standards and shortlisted 3 options that showed significant improvement in terms of carbon performance, costs, resources and durability compared to the initial design.
Result
Saving approx. £3m, - 55% co2
